Lawn drain installation services involve setting up specialized drainage systems designed to manage excess water in outdoor areas. These systems typically include the placement of perforated pipes, catch basins, and gravel beds to facilitate proper water flow away from lawns, gardens, and property foundations. The installation process aims to create an effective drainage network that prevents water accumulation, reducing the risk of flooding and water-related damage. Professional landscapers or drainage specialists assess the terrain and soil conditions to design a tailored drainage solution that integrates seamlessly with existing landscaping features.

This service addresses common issues caused by inadequate drainage, such as water pooling, erosion, and soggy ground conditions. Excess water can weaken soil stability, damage plant roots, and lead to the formation of unsightly puddles. In colder climates, poor drainage can contribute to ice formation, increasing the risk of slips and falls. Proper lawn drain installation helps alleviate these problems by directing water away from critical areas, protecting property value, and maintaining a healthy lawn. It is especially beneficial in regions with high rainfall or properties situated on slopes where water runoff tends to accumulate.

The overview below groups typical Lawn Drains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Tuscaloosa, AL.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Installation Costs - The typical cost for installing lawn drains ranges from $500 to $2,500, depending on the size and complexity of the project. For example, a basic system in Tuscaloosa might cost around $800, while larger installations can reach $2,000 or more.

Material Expenses - The price of materials for lawn drain installation generally falls between $200 and $1,200. This includes drainage pipes, gravel, and other necessary components, with costs varying based on quality and quantity needed.

Labor Charges - Labor costs for installing lawn drains usually range from $300 to $1,500. Factors influencing this include the project's scope, site accessibility, and local labor rates in Tuscaloosa and nearby areas.

Additional Costs - Extra expenses such as site preparation, grading, or permits can add $100 to $800 to the overall cost. These costs depend on specific site conditions and local regulations affecting lawn drain installations.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are lawn drains used for? Lawn drains help prevent water accumulation and improve drainage in yards, reducing the risk of flooding and water damage.

How long does it take to install a lawn drain? Installation times vary depending on the size and complexity of the project, but generally, it can take from a few hours to a full day.

What types of lawn drains are available? Common options include surface drains, French drains, and channel drains, each suited for different drainage needs.

Can lawn drains be installed in any yard? Most yards can accommodate lawn drain installation, but a local service provider can assess site-specific conditions.

Is lawn drain installation disruptive to my yard? Installation may involve some disturbance to the landscape, but professional contractors aim to minimize impact during the process.
